Migration Steps by Category
1. Configuration File Updates
1.1 Coverage Configuration
Search Pattern: coverage in all vitest.config.* files and project.json test target options
Changes Required:
// ❌ BEFORE (Vitest 3.x)
export default defineConfig({
test: {
coverage: {
all: true,
extensions: ['.ts', '.tsx'],
ignoreEmptyLines: false,
experimentalAstAwareRemapping: true,
},
},
});
// ✅ AFTER (Vitest 4.0)
export default defineConfig({
test: {
coverage: {
// Explicitly define files to include in coverage
include: ['src/**/*.{ts,tsx}'],
// Remove: all, extensions, ignoreEmptyLines, experimentalAstAwareRemapping
},
},
});
Action Items:
- Remove
coverage.alloption - Remove
coverage.extensionsoption - Remove
coverage.ignoreEmptyLinesoption - Remove
coverage.experimentalAstAwareRemappingoption - Add explicit
coverage.includepatterns based on project structure - Update any documentation referencing these options
1.2 Pool Options Restructuring
Search Pattern: poolOptions, maxThreads, maxForks, singleThread, singleFork in all Vitest config files
Changes Required:
// ❌ BEFORE (Vitest 3.x)
export default defineConfig({
test: {
maxThreads: 4,
maxForks: 2,
singleThread: false,
poolOptions: {
threads: {
useAtomics: true,
},
vmThreads: {
memoryLimit: '512MB',
},
},
},
});
// ✅ AFTER (Vitest 4.0)
export default defineConfig({
test: {
maxWorkers: 4, // Consolidates maxThreads and maxForks
isolate: true, // Replaces singleThread: false
// Remove: poolOptions, threads.useAtomics
vmMemoryLimit: '512MB', // Moved to top-level
},
});
Action Items:
- Replace
maxThreadsandmaxForkswith singlemaxWorkersoption - Replace
singleThread: trueorsingleFork: truewithmaxWorkers: 1, isolate: false - Move all
poolOptions.*nested options to top-level (e.g.,poolOptions.vmThreads.memoryLimit→vmMemoryLimit) - Remove
threads.useAtomicsoption - Update CI environment variables:
VITEST_MAX_THREADSandVITEST_MAX_FORKS→VITEST_MAX_WORKERS
1.3 Workspace to Projects Rename
Search Pattern: workspace property in Vitest config files
Changes Required:
// ❌ BEFORE (Vitest 3.x)
export default defineConfig({
test: {
workspace: ['apps/*', 'libs/*'],
},
});
// ✅ AFTER (Vitest 4.0)
export default defineConfig({
test: {
projects: ['apps/*', 'libs/*'],
},
});
Action Items:
- Rename
workspaceproperty toprojectsin all config files - Remove external workspace file references (must be inline in config)
- Update
poolMatchGlobsto useprojectspattern matching instead - Update
environmentMatchGlobsto useprojectspattern matching instead
1.4 Browser Configuration
Search Pattern: browser.provider, browser.testerScripts, imports from @vitest/browser
Changes Required:
// ❌ BEFORE (Vitest 3.x)
export default defineConfig({
test: {
browser: {
enabled: true,
provider: 'playwright', // String value
testerScripts: ['./setup.js'],
},
},
});
// Import changes
import { page } from '@vitest/browser';
// ✅ AFTER (Vitest 4.0)
export default defineConfig({
test: {
browser: {
enabled: true,
provider: { name: 'playwright' }, // Object value
testerHtmlPath: './test-setup.html', // Renamed from testerScripts
},
},
});
// Import changes
import { page } from 'vitest/browser';
Action Items:
- Convert
browser.providerstring values to object format:{ name: 'provider-name' } - Replace
browser.testerScriptswithbrowser.testerHtmlPath - Update all imports from
@vitest/browsertovitest/browser - Remove
@vitest/browserfrom dependencies if no longer needed
1.5 Deprecated Configuration Options
Search Pattern: deps.external, deps.inline, deps.fallbackCJS in config files
Changes Required:
// ❌ BEFORE (Vitest 3.x)
export default defineConfig({
test: {
deps: {
external: ['some-package'],
inline: ['inline-package'],
fallbackCJS: true,
},
},
});
// ✅ AFTER (Vitest 4.0)
export default defineConfig({
test: {
server: {
deps: {
external: ['some-package'],
inline: ['inline-package'],
fallbackCJS: true,
},
},
},
});
Action Items:
- Move
deps.*options underserver.depsnamespace - Remove
poolMatchGlobs(useprojectswith conditions instead) - Remove
environmentMatchGlobs(useprojectswith conditions instead)
2. Test Code Updates
2.1 Mock Function Name Changes
Search Pattern: .getMockName() calls in test files
Changes Required:
// ❌ BEFORE (Vitest 3.x)
const mockFn = vi.fn();
expect(mockFn.getMockName()).toBe('spy'); // Old default
// ✅ AFTER (Vitest 4.0)
const mockFn = vi.fn();
expect(mockFn.getMockName()).toBe('vi.fn()'); // New default
// If you need custom names, set them explicitly
const namedMock = vi.fn().mockName('myCustomName');
expect(namedMock.getMockName()).toBe('myCustomName');
Action Items:
- Update test assertions checking default mock names from
'spy'to'vi.fn()' - Add explicit
.mockName()calls where specific names are required
2.2 Mock Invocation Call Order
Search Pattern: .mock.invocationCallOrder in test files
Changes Required:
// ❌ BEFORE (Vitest 3.x)
const mockFn = vi.fn();
mockFn();
expect(mockFn.mock.invocationCallOrder[0]).toBe(0); // Started at 0
// ✅ AFTER (Vitest 4.0)
const mockFn = vi.fn();
mockFn();
expect(mockFn.mock.invocationCallOrder[0]).toBe(1); // Now starts at 1 (Jest-compatible)
Action Items:
- Update assertions on
invocationCallOrderto account for 1-based indexing - Search for off-by-one errors in call order comparisons
2.3 Constructor Spies and Mocks
Search Pattern: vi.spyOn on constructors, vi.fn() used as constructors
Changes Required:
// ❌ BEFORE (Vitest 3.x) - Arrow function constructors might have worked
const MockConstructor = vi.fn(() => ({ value: 42 }));
new MockConstructor(); // May have worked in v3
// ✅ AFTER (Vitest 4.0) - Must use function or class
const MockConstructor = vi.fn(function () {
return { value: 42 };
});
new MockConstructor(); // Correctly supports 'new'
// Or use class syntax
class MockClass {
value = 42;
}
const MockConstructor = vi.fn(MockClass);
Action Items:
- Convert arrow function mocks used as constructors to
functionkeyword orclasssyntax - Test all constructor spies to ensure
newkeyword works correctly - Update any mocks that expect constructor behavior
2.4 RestoreAllMocks Behavior
Search Pattern: vi.restoreAllMocks() in test files
Changes Required:
// ❌ BEFORE (Vitest 3.x)
vi.mock('./module', () => ({ fn: vi.fn() }));
vi.restoreAllMocks(); // Would restore automocks
// ✅ AFTER (Vitest 4.0)
vi.mock('./module', () => ({ fn: vi.fn() }));
vi.restoreAllMocks(); // Only restores manual spies, NOT automocks
// To reset automocks, use:
vi.unmock('./module');
// or
vi.resetModules();
Action Items:
- Review all
vi.restoreAllMocks()usage - Add explicit
vi.unmock()orvi.resetModules()calls for automocked modules - Ensure test isolation is maintained after this change
2.5 SpyOn Return Value Changes
Search Pattern: vi.spyOn() on already mocked functions
Changes Required:
// ❌ BEFORE (Vitest 3.x)
const mock = vi.fn();
const spy = vi.spyOn({ method: mock }, 'method');
// spy !== mock (created new spy)
// ✅ AFTER (Vitest 4.0)
const mock = vi.fn();
const spy = vi.spyOn({ method: mock }, 'method');
// spy === mock (returns same instance)
Action Items:
- Review code that creates spies on existing mocks
- Remove redundant spy creation if same instance is returned
- Update assertions that check spy identity
2.6 Automock Behavior Changes
Search Pattern: vi.mock() with factory functions, .mockRestore() on automocks
Changes Required:
// ❌ BEFORE (Vitest 3.x)
vi.mock('./utils', () => ({
get value() {
return 42;
}, // Would call getter
}));
import { value } from './utils';
console.log(value); // Would execute getter logic
// Restore might have worked
const spy = vi.spyOn(obj, 'method');
spy.mockRestore(); // Might work on automocks
// ✅ AFTER (Vitest 4.0)
vi.mock('./utils', () => ({
get value() {
return 42;
},
}));
import { value } from './utils';
console.log(value); // Returns undefined (doesn't call getter)
// Explicitly return value if needed
vi.mock('./utils', () => ({
value: 42, // Not a getter
}));
// mockRestore no longer works on automocks
const spy = vi.spyOn(obj, 'method');
spy.mockRestore(); // Throws error if method is automocked
// Use unmock instead
vi.unmock('./module');
Action Items:
- Convert automocked getters to plain property values where needed
- Remove
.mockRestore()calls on automocked methods - Use
vi.unmock()to clear automocks instead - Test instance method isolation (they now share state with prototype)
2.7 Settled Results Immediate Population
Search Pattern: .mock.settledResults in test files
Changes Required:
// ✅ AFTER (Vitest 4.0)
const asyncMock = vi.fn(async () => 'result');
const promise = asyncMock();
// settledResults is immediately populated with 'incomplete' status
expect(asyncMock.mock.settledResults[0]).toEqual({
type: 'incomplete',
value: undefined,
});
// After promise resolves
await promise;
expect(asyncMock.mock.settledResults[0]).toEqual({
type: 'fulfilled',
value: 'result',
});
Action Items:
- Update tests that check
settledResultsbefore promise resolution - Handle
'incomplete'status in assertions - Ensure tests properly await promises before checking settled results

3.2 Built-in Reporter Changes
Search Pattern: reporters: ['basic'], reporters: ['verbose']
Changes Required:
// ❌ BEFORE (Vitest 3.x)
export default defineConfig({
test: {
reporters: ['basic'],
},
});
// ✅ AFTER (Vitest 4.0)
export default defineConfig({
test: {
reporters: [['default', { summary: false }]], // Equivalent to 'basic'
},
});
// For verbose (tree output)
reporters: ['tree']; // Use 'tree' for hierarchical output
Action Items:
- Replace
'basic'reporter with['default', { summary: false }] - Replace
'verbose'reporter with'tree'for hierarchical output - Update CI configuration if reporters are specified there
4. Snapshot Changes
4.1 Custom Elements Shadow Root
Search Pattern: Snapshot tests involving custom elements or Web Components
Changes Required:
// ✅ AFTER (Vitest 4.0)
// Shadow root contents now printed by default in snapshots
// If you want old behavior (don't print shadow root):
export default defineConfig({
test: {
printShadowRoot: false,
},
});
Action Items:
- Review snapshot tests for custom elements
- Update snapshots if shadow root contents are now included
- Add
printShadowRoot: falseif old behavior is required
5. Environment Variable Updates
Search Pattern: CI/CD configuration files, .env files, documentation
Changes Required:
# ❌ BEFORE (Vitest 3.x)
VITEST_MAX_THREADS=4
VITEST_MAX_FORKS=2
VITE_NODE_DEPS_MODULE_DIRECTORIES=/custom/path
# ✅ AFTER (Vitest 4.0)
VITEST_MAX_WORKERS=4
VITEST_MODULE_DIRECTORIES=/custom/path
Action Items:
- Update CI/CD pipeline environment variables
- Update
.envfiles - Update documentation referencing old environment variables
- Search for
VITEST_MAX_THREADS,VITEST_MAX_FORKS,VITE_NODE_DEPS_MODULE_DIRECTORIES

Common Issues and Solutions
Issue: Coverage includes too many files
Solution: Add explicit coverage.include patterns to match your source files
Issue: Tests fail with "arrow function constructors not supported"
Solution: Convert arrow functions used as constructors to function keyword or class syntax
Issue: Automocks not resetting between tests
Solution: Use vi.unmock() or vi.resetModules() instead of vi.restoreAllMocks()
Issue: Mock call order assertions failing
Solution: Update to 1-based indexing for invocationCallOrder
Issue: Browser tests failing after upgrade
Solution: Check browser provider is object format and imports use vitest/browser
Issue: TypeScript errors in test files
Solution: Update to new type definitions and remove usage of deprecated types
